Although Deng Xiaoping and Chen Yi were both Sichuanese and both went to a foreign country in their early years to pursue the road to national salvation, they did not know each other when they were in France. Chen Yi went to France a year before Deng Xiaoping, but there he experienced a series of difficulties such as missing school, unemployment, and exploitation by capitalists, and his resistance struggle with Zhou Enlai and others was suppressed by the French military and police, and he was finally forced to return to China. At the same time, Deng Xiaoping's experience abroad was similar to that of Chen Yi. It was not until 1930 that the two Sichuan villagers met. Since then, their friendship has grown stronger as they have come into contact and get to know each other. They fought side by side in different positions in the Central Soviet Region, and during the War of Resistance Against Japan, they each led troops to jointly fight against the Japanese army invading China and the Kuomintang reactionaries, and achieved brilliant victories. Over the years, they have been both comrades-in-arms and close comrades. Despite their different ages and personalities, one is taciturn and the other is bold and humorous, this does not affect the deep feelings between them.

With the establishment of New China, Deng Xiaoping and Chen Yi were successively transferred to the Central Committee to assist Premier Zhou Enlai for more than ten years. Later, they became neighbors of Zhongnanhai, and the back window of Deng Xiaoping's house faced the front yard of Chen Yi's house, so the relationship between the two families became closer. Sometimes, Deng Xiaoping and his wife would visit Chen Yi's home with their children, Chen Yi's daughter Chen Shanshan and Deng Xiaoping's daughter are the same age, and the two little girls have grown up together, whether in the school, the Children's Palace, the swimming pool or the yard, you can see them playing hand in hand. Chen Yi's home became a frequent haunt for Deng Xiaoping's daughter, Mao Mao. Chen Shanshan would take Mao Mao to excitedly see her father's majestic marshal uniform and various large medals symbolizing honor. Sometimes, Chen Shanshan would take Mao Mao to visit her brother's university dormitory to learn about the living environment of high-achieving students at the University of Science and Technology of China.

However, with the transfer of work, the two gradually drifted apart. When Chen Yi died in 1972, Deng Xiaoping's family was living in Jiangxi, and they were shocked and saddened to hear the bad news. The sudden death of an old comrade-in-arms is difficult to accept. Deng Xiaoping could no longer visit Chen Yi with durian or share wine with him.

The following year, Deng Xiaoping was transferred back to Beijing, where he learned that Zhang Qian had cancer. Mr. and Mrs. Deng Xiaoping immediately took their daughter Mao Mao to visit Zhang Qian in the hospital. And this diagnosis was made shortly after Chen Yi's death. At that time, Zhang Qian's physical condition was already very bad, she often coughed up blood, and now she has lung cancer, which is an even worse blow for Zhang Qian and her family. However, the optimistic Zhang Qian still insisted on smiling and accelerated the speed of sorting out her husband's posthumous manuscripts. She knows that her life is short, but she has to race against time to fulfill her husband's last wish. On the third day after the operation, although her health was weak, Zhang Qian began to sort out the manuscripts of poetry left by her husband.

Although the doctor advised her to rest, Zhang Qian smiled and said: "I still have physical strength..." After months of persistent work, she finally completed the "Selected Poems of Chen Yi" in December 1972, and breathed a sigh of relief. In 1973, Mao Mao met Chen Shanshan in the hospital, and the two friends who had not seen each other for many years were reunited again. At that time, Chen Shanshan had just returned from studying abroad, and she had been accompanying and taking care of her mother. Zhang Qian was tortured by the disease, and Deng Xiaoping's family was in a heavy mood, but they could not change the reality.

A year later, Zhang Qian's health deteriorated sharply and she was unable to get out of bed. She knows that she may die at any time, but she has fulfilled her husband's last wish, and her only concern is her children. Deng Xiaoping, a friend of many years, saw Zhang Qian's concern. So, in front of Zhang Qian's hospital bed, he solemnly promised: "I will take good care of Shanshan, and I will care for her like my own daughter!" These words made Zhang Qian let go of some worries in her heart. Finally, on March 20, 1973, Zhang Qian passed away peacefully...
